    MYLAPORE GOWRI AMMA [ 1892-1971]

    Most connoisseurs of classical dance in India will agree that if a count of about half a dozen greatest classical dancers of India in the 20th century is taken, the legendary Mylapore Gowri Amma, Rukmini Devi’s first Guru, would easily be one among them.

    She was the last bastion of the Devadasis attached to the Kapaleeshwara Temple, Mylapore, Madras, who held the dignity and honour of her profession until the Anti-Nautchl Bill was passed by the government and the Devadasi system was abolished.


    To most classical dancers, Gowri Amma represented pinnacle of perfection who was particularly noted for the perfect synchronization of muscle movement and emotions.

    Gowri Amma was the senior most among the well known Bharathanatyam dancers in the early part of 20th century when classical dance was slowly emerging as an art form in its own right.
